 //Checks tree for "aaabbc" which is "6 *97:3 3 *99:1 *98:2"
 public void CheckSimpleTree(HuffmansTree.Node root)
 {
     Assert.IsNotNull(root);
     Assert.IsNull(root.Left.Left);
     Assert.IsNull(root.Left.Right);
     Assert.IsNull(root.Right.Left.Left);
     Assert.IsNull(root.Right.Left.Right);
     Assert.IsNull(root.Right.Right.Left);
     Assert.IsNull(root.Right.Right.Right);
     Assert.AreEqual((ulong)6, root.Sum);
     Assert.AreEqual((ulong)3, root.Left.Sum);
     Assert.AreEqual((ulong)3, root.Right.Sum);
     Assert.AreEqual((ulong)1, root.Right.Left.Sum);
     Assert.AreEqual((ulong)2, root.Right.Right.Sum);
     Assert.AreEqual((ulong)0, root.Code);
     Assert.AreEqual((byte)97, root.Left.Code);
     Assert.AreEqual((byte)0, root.Right.Code);
     Assert.AreEqual((byte)99, root.Right.Left.Code);
     Assert.AreEqual((byte)98, root.Right.Right.Code);
     Assert.AreNotEqual((ulong)0, root.Order);
     Assert.AreEqual((ulong)0, root.Left.Order);
     Assert.AreNotEqual((ulong)0, root.Right.Order);
     Assert.AreEqual((ulong)0, root.Right.Left.Order);
     Assert.AreEqual((ulong)0, root.Right.Right.Order);
 }
